Drain Trenching in Atlanta, GA

Drain trenching services involve digging narrow, deep channels in the ground to install or repair underground drainage systems. This process is commonly used for projects such as installing new drain lines, managing surface water runoff, or addressing existing drainage issues around homes and yards. Homeowners typically request drain trenching when preparing for landscaping projects, installing irrigation systems, or resolving problems caused by poor drainage that can lead to water pooling or foundation concerns.

Before requesting drain trenching, property owners should consider the location and extent of the drainage work needed, as well as any underground utilities that may be present. It’s important to understand the purpose of the trenching-whether for new installations or repairs-and to communicate details about the property's layout. Proper planning ensures the trenching aligns with existing infrastructure and meets drainage goals effectively.

Project Types

Common Drain Trenching Jobs

Drain trenching - creates a dedicated channel for effective water drainage away from foundations.

Landscape drainage - helps prevent water pooling in yards and garden areas.

Foundation drainage - reduces the risk of water infiltration and structural damage.

Stormwater management - directs rainwater runoff to prevent erosion and flooding.

Yard grading - improves surface slope for better water flow and drainage.

Sump drain installation - provides a reliable pathway for excess water to exit basement or crawl spaces.

FAQ

Drain Trenching Questions

What is drain trenching used for? Drain trenching creates channels in the ground to redirect water away from foundations, basements, or landscaping areas to prevent flooding and water damage.

What types of projects require drain trenching? This service is often needed for installing new drainage systems, repairing existing drainage issues, or managing excess surface water around properties.

How deep are drain trenches typically dug? Trenches are usually excavated to a depth that effectively directs water flow, often between 12 to 24 inches, depending on the project requirements.

What materials are used in drain trenching? Common materials include perforated pipes, gravel, and filter fabric, which work together to facilitate proper drainage and prevent clogging.
